Publisher's Note Let nature be your guide to creating inspiring and elegant floral designs! By looking in the wild or in the garden, its easy to develop an artistic eye -- and these step-by-step projects and brilliant photos will show you exactly how to take and adapt ideas from nature using whatever is available. General information covers floral line, color, texture, and shape; equipment; and even containers. Then try arrangements drawn from the woods, the riverbank, the meadow, and the beach. Make an Alpine Meadow Bowl a Seashell-and-Candles arrangement, or a mixture of willow, water, and hellebores. Set bluebells in moss and daisies in meadow grass. Move into the kitchen garden and hand-tie herbs, or put together a vibrantly colorful Harvest Ring. Set out a simple and rustic flower seed tray, a Cherry Blossom Basket from the orchard, or planted jasmine and gardenias from the conservatory. You'll find creating these beautiful arrangements so enjoyable that flowers will soon be blossoming throughout the house!
